Ingredients
– 2 pounds stewing beef, trimmed and cubed
– 3 tablespoons flour
– Β½ teaspoon garlic powder
– Β½ teaspoon salt
– Β½ teaspoon black pepper
– 3 tablespoons olive oil, more as needed
– 1 onion, chopped
– 6 cups beef broth
– Β½ cup red wine (optional)
– 1 pound potatoes, peeled and cubed
– 4 carrots, cut into 1-inch pieces
– 4 ribs celery, cut into 1-inch pieces
– 3 tablespoons tomato paste
– 1 teaspoon dried rosemary or 1 sprig fresh
– 2 tablespoons cornstarch or as needed
– 2 tablespoons water or as needed
– ΒΎ cup peas
Instructions
1-In a bowl, combine the flour, garlic powder, salt, and pepper, then toss the beef in this mixture to coat it evenly.
2-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Shake off excess flour from the beef pieces and brown them in small batches, then set them aside for later.
3-Add the chopped onion to the pot and cook for about 3 minutes, until it starts to soften and release its aroma.
4-Pour in the beef broth and red wine if youβre using it, and scrape up any brown bits from the bottom of the pot to boost the flavor.
5-Stir in the browned beef, potatoes, carrots, celery, tomato paste, and rosemary. Reduce the heat to medium-low, cover the pot, and simmer for 1 hour or until the beef is tender it might take up to 90 minutes.
6-To thicken the stew, mix equal parts cornstarch and water to make a slurry. Slowly add it to the boiling stew and stir until it thickens, letting it boil for 1-2 minutes to remove any starchy taste.
7-Finally, stir in the peas and simmer for 5-10 minutes. Taste and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per as needed.

π₯ Searing beef first develops rich, caramelized flavor.
π± Add peas last as they cook quickly.
βοΈ Freeze portions for later; thaw in fridge or microwave before reheating.
